I also tend to either add larger wandering hordes or play overhauls that already have larger wandering hordes built in. Right now I'm playing the Wild West overhaul and that spawns hordes of a dozen or more right from day one. It's also made much harder by the very different availability of guns because it's set roughly parallel to the mid-late 19th century in the real world. In that mod, the gatling gun was invented shortly before the apocalypse. It's very rare. And that's your lot for automatic weapons.
EDIT: My only gripe with the Wild West overhaul is that the Craft From Containers modlet isn't compatible with it. I've become very used to the convenience of that mod. If I install both, I get a Wild West overhaul loading screen showing constantly. The gameworld loads in and I have move, access my inventory, skills, etc, but I can't see the gameworld.
